Social Security payments are a crucial lifeline for millions of Americans, and with June 2025 approaching, many retirees and disability beneficiaries are wondering when their checks will arrive and if anything is changing.
Fortunately, the payment calendar remains consistent, but there are some new developments to be aware of. Here’s what you need to know:
**Payment Schedule:**
* June 3: Supplemental Security Income (SSI) recipients and those who began receiving Social Security before May 1997 will receive their payments.
* June 12: Individuals with birthdays between the 1st and 10th of any month will receive benefits.
* June 18: Those born between the 11th and 20th will receive payments, delayed by one day due to Juneteenth (June 19).
* June 25: Recipients with birthdays from the 21st to 31st will receive their checks.

**Garnishment Alert:**
Starting in June 2025, certain Social Security recipients with outstanding federal student loans may face an automatic 15% garnishment of their monthly benefits. This policy is authorized under the Debt Collection Improvement Act and aims to recover defaulted loan balances.
**Who Is Affected?**
Retirees and disability beneficiaries with outstanding federal student loans in default status are at risk.
